Make FileSystem files and OS files distinct (#2383)
* #include an absolute path didn't work - because paths were taken to always be relative.
* Make DownstreamCompileOptions use POD types.
* CharSliceAllocator -> SliceAllocator
Added SliceConverter
CharSliceCaster -> SliceCaster
* First attempt at zero terminating around blobs.
* Fix clang warning.
* Add SlangTerminatedChars
Make Blob implementations support it.
Make most blobs 'terminated'.
* Fix bug setting up sourceFiles for CommandLineDownstreamCompiler.
* Traffic in TerminatedCharSlice for sourceFiles.
Use ArtifactDesc to generate temporary file names for source.
* Fix typo in testing for shared library/C++.
* Working with source being passed as artifacts to DownstreamCompiler.
* Use artifacts in SourceManager/SourceFile.
* Support infering extension from the original file extension.
* * Infer extension if can't determine from the artifact type
* Split IOSFile/IExtFile representations
* Move responsibility for creating OS file to the handler.
* Disable the check memory path.
